Florida's modern role in national issues stems from its unique history and diverse population. From Native American tribes to European colonization, and later statehood in 1845, Florida's past has shaped its present-day significance. As a swing state with a large electoral college, Florida wields considerable influence in national politics. Its stance on healthcare, immigration, climate change, and gun control often mirrors broader national debates, making it a microcosm of American political discourse.
